=========================PhoneGap================================== // Waiting to load phonegap Document.addeventlistener ("Deviceready", ondeviceready, false);// phonegap loading Complete function Ondeviceready () {// button event Document.addeventlistener ("Backbutton", eventbackbutton, false); // return key}// return key Function eventbackbutton () {if ($ (". Classobj"). Is (": visible")) {alert (' One more click to exit! '); Document.removeeventlistener ("Backbutton", eventbackbutton, false); // Logoff return key Document.addeventlistener ("Backbutton", exitapp, false);// bind exit event// 3 seconds after re-registration var Intervalid = window.setinterval (function () {window.clearinterval (intervalid); Document.removeeventlistener ("Backbutton", exitapp, false); // Logout return key Document.addeventlistener ("Backbutton", eventbackbutton, false); // return key}, 3000);} else {// navigator.app.backhistory ();}} FunctiOn exitapp () {navigator.app.exitapp ();}
Android button click once to exit